On 8/11/25 10:57 AM, Alice Ryhl wrote:
> On Fri, Aug 08, 2025 at 08:10:18PM +0200, Danilo Krummrich wrote:
>> The IntoPageIter trait provides a common interface for types that
>> provide a page iterator, such as VmallocPageIter.
>>
>> Subsequent patches will leverage this to let VBox and VVec provide a
>> VmallocPageIter though this trait.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Danilo Krummrich <dakr@kernel.org>
> 
> If you call this trait Into*Iter, then it should take ownership of the
> underlying object. Since you only borrow it, I would suggest calling
> this AsPageIter instead (or go back to a name like PageOwner that
> doesn't need to follow these naming conventions).

Agreed, I think we should call it AsPageIter then.
